A crypto physical wallet can be described as a tool that allows users to securely save their cryptocurrency offline. This is crucial as it adds an additional layer of security compared to software wallets, which are stored on a laptop or a mobile device and are susceptible to hacking and malware.
Hardware wallets are typically small portable devices that connect to a computer via USB. They store the user’s private keys, which are used to access their cryptocurrency on the device itself, instead of on a laptop computer or mobile device. This means that even if a hacker could gain access to a user’s computer or mobile device, they wouldn’t be able to gain access to the cryptocurrency stored by the user since the private keys are kept offline.
Hardware wallets are also designed to be user-friendly, making it easy for even non-technical users to safely store their cryptocurrency. They usually have a straightforward interface and can be used with a variety of different currencies.
